The IBM 2.20GHz Intel Xeon E7-4850 v3 processor offers a solid multi-core setup with 14 cores, designed for heavy enterprise workloads. It fits into LGA2011 sockets and is tailored for servers needing extensive cache and fast processor communication. This CPU is a practical component in data centers and large-scale computing systems, focusing on steady performance and efficient data handling. |

| Processor Family | Xeon E7 |
| # Of Cores | 14 Core |
| Total Threads | 28 |
| Max Turbo Frequency | 3.00 GHz |
| Base Clock Speed | 2.20 GHz |
| PCIe Version | PCIe 3.0 |
| Lithography | 22 nm |
| Socket Type | LGA 2011 |
| Cache | 35 MB |
Memory Specifications |
|
|---|---|
| Memory Types | DDR4 |
| Max Memory Channels | 4 |
| Bandwidth | 68 GB/s |
